Output ac5691529c4b61aadead9990423c6dee7909c4e4f41d9531fa06680be64af458:1

value
3470400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8cd03bfeefb6d36c9373f64dcf9bb6c0ddd649 OP_EQUAL
address
35w9hFn2tncyt6FY24wrTAtL1QTgTRFAJ3
transaction
ac5691529c4b61aadead9990423c6dee7909c4e4f41d9531fa06680be64af458
confirmations
389179
spent
true